 Leonard H. Lamb

Leonard H. Lamb, 85, of 211 E. 28th St. S. died of congestive heart failure Tuesday. Oct. 23, at Skiff Medical Center in Newton. Funeral services will be Saturday at 10:30 a.m. at Reese Chapel in Newton with the Rev. Steven Seehorn officiating. Burial will be at Newton Union Cemetery. Reese Funeral Home in Newton is handling arrangements. Friends may call Friday after 1 p.m. at the funeral home where family will be present from 6:30 to 8 p.m. Memorials will be accepted to Hospice of Jasper County.

 The son of Harrison and Nellie Harness Lamb, he was born Feb. 25, 1916, in Malcomb. He attended Malcomb schools. In 1950 he married Avonne Bruce in Newton. They moved from Grinnell to Newton in 1958. He worked in Assembly at the Maytag Company, retiring in 1976. Mr. Lamb was a member of First United Methodist Church and life member of VFW UAW        # 997.

 Survivors include his wife; a son and daughter in-law, David and Dawn of Newton; two grandsons: two brothers, John of Waterloo and Brook of Grinnell; three sisters, Violet Seehorn of Ankeny, Addie Gray of Hemet, Calif., and Joyce Laird of Chandler, Ariz. He was preceded in death by his parents, two brothers, two sisters and a grandson.

  Newton Daily News, Newton, IA, October 24, 2001.
